I had all the trouble on my SS with ZL1 Aero.
Now with my ZL1 it starts again. Big hole in the fender line on rear driving wheel, luckily it doesnt seem to rub on the harness. Passenger front wheels also rubs through the liner already. What I did on my SS few years ago, I will do now again. Fixing holes with fiberglass and resin. Overall using some resin to stiffen up all the fender liners. When you soak it with resin, I use something like a small wooden stick between tire and fender liner so it dries and gets solid with more space. When it completly dried, just spray paint over and you wont notice it at all. New fender liner will start to rub rub sooner or later as well, don't ask me how I know, lol. But don't stiffen it too much, in case you want to remove the fender liner one day... Also may tape off your rims and sidewall of the tires, once you see dried resin there, you wont get rid of it.
